Is it necessary to train WRIST WRENCH and Rolling Thunder at the same time? Don't they overlap about the same in grip strength?
@yvesgravelle
@yvesgravelle 12 күн бұрын
No, it’s definitely not necessary. You could do it on the same session to vary the workload and build better anaerobic capacity. Most grip comps have multiple events and can be run over multiple days so being strong I sometimes not enough. You have to also be fit and ready for the demand of the sport.
